Jesuit Father Edwin L. Gros blessed a plaque in St. Louis Cemetery No. 1 sponsored by the National Society Daughters of the American Revolution’s Spirit of ’76 chapter to honor the 265 Louisiana patriots who fought in the Revolutionary War under Gen. Bernardo de Gálvez.
Most of the patriots are buried in St. Louis Cemetery No. 1. A year-long effort that included research, national approvals and planning paved the way for the plaque. The dedication was part of the “America250!” celebration,” which commemorates the 250th anniversary of the Revolutionary War. Robert Gray Freeland, right above, portrayed Gálvez in full uniform and answered questions about Gálvez at a luncheon.
